Invoice Factoring in Leominster, MA

Most Leominster plastics & injection molding shops we place into factoring are waiting 30–90 days on Northeast distributors, big-box buyers, or government contracts. Factoring turns those invoices into cash within days so payroll and material buys don't stall between deposits.

Who typically qualifies

  • Selling on net terms to creditworthy commercial or government customers (common across plastics & injection molding and packaging manufacturing in MA).
  • At least a few months of invoicing history — personal credit and time in business matter less than your buyers' credit.
  • No conflicting UCC-1 filing on your receivables (we help review this before you sign anything).

Equipment Financing in Leominster, MA

Leominster shops adding CNC capacity, robotics, tooling, or production vehicles use equipment financing to keep cash on hand for materials and labor. New or used, vendor or private-party — the equipment itself carries most of the underwriting weight.

Who typically qualifies

  • A plastics & injection molding-relevant piece of equipment identified (quote, invoice, or listing).
  • Typically 1+ year in business in MA; startup and challenged-credit programs exist with a larger down payment.
  • Down payment often 0–20% depending on equipment type, age, and your profile.

Purchase Order Financing in Leominster, MA

When a Leominster manufacturer lands a purchase order that's bigger than current cash on hand — a new Northeast retailer, a defense sub-tier award, an export contract — PO financing pays your suppliers so you can actually deliver, then unwinds when your customer pays.

Who typically qualifies

  • A confirmed PO from a creditworthy end buyer (common with plastics & injection molding and packaging manufacturing customers).
  • Gross margin typically 20%+ so the deal supports supplier costs and financing.
  • A finished-goods or light-assembly production model — pure raw-material speculation usually doesn't qualify.

Asset-Based Lending (ABL) in Leominster, MA

Established Leominster manufacturers with steady A/R, inventory, and equipment on the books use ABL as a revolving line of credit that scales with the business. Lower cost of capital than factoring, with monthly reporting instead of invoice-by-invoice.

Who typically qualifies

  • Typically $5M+ in annual revenue and clean financials (many MA plastics & injection molding shops fit this profile at scale).
  • Receivables, inventory, and/or M&E to borrow against; regular borrowing-base reporting.
  • Audited or reviewed financials help — we'll tell you upfront if a file needs cleanup first.

Working Capital in Leominster, MA

Short-term working capital fills a specific gap for Leominster shops — a materials run before a big delivery, a payroll bridge between customer payments, a repair that can't wait. Structured as a term advance repaid from daily or weekly deposits.

Who typically qualifies

  • At least 6–12 months in business with consistent revenue deposits from Northeast customers.
  • Roughly $15K+ average monthly revenue; higher amounts unlock better structures.
  • No open bankruptcy; recent tax liens or judgments discussed openly upfront so we place you correctly.
